Section 21-7-4

Right of blind or partially blind persons or hearing-impaired persons to be accompanied by guide or hearing dog.

Every totally or partially blind person shall have the right to be accompanied by a guide dog, especially trained for the purpose, and every hearing-impaired person shall have the right to be accompanied by a hearing dog, especially trained for the purpose, and every person employed by an accredited school for training guide dogs shall have the right to be accompanied by a guide dog in training in any of the places listed in Section 21-7-3 without being required to pay an extra charge for the dog however, the person shall be liable for any damages done to the premises or facilities by the dog.

(Acts 1975, No. 869, p. 1711, §2; Acts 1982, No. 82-527, p. 877, § 1; Act 99-698, 2nd Sp. Sess., p. 298, §1; Act 2001-344, p. 446, §1.)
